公共场所集中空调通风系统污染与卫生学评价

摘    要:目的 调查评价公共场所集中空调通风系统污染状况,为卫生管理提供依据。方法 随机抽取深圳市各类公共场所20个集中空调通风系统,检查各部件清洁度;检测冷却塔水中军团菌、空调送风中可吸入颗粒物(PM10)、细菌总数、真菌总数、溶血性链球菌含量。结果 20个空调系统的250个部件中,有24%有尘粒,5%有污垢。未发现菌霉斑;空调送风中污染物的平均日均值分别为:可吸入颗粒物(PM10)0.12mg/m^ 3,细菌总数291cfu/m^3,真菌总数273cfu/m^3,未检出溶血性链球菌;分别有10%,5%的空调系统送风中可吸入颗粒物(PM10)、细菌总数超标;采集49份冷却塔水样,未检出军团菌。结论 公共场所集中空调通风系统仍存在卫生问题,应加强卫生管理。
